How to correct a child's hunchback?

The problem of hunchback will greatly damage our appearance. Nowadays, many children have the problem of hunchback. Many mothers are particularly worried and don’t know what method to use to help our children treat the problem of hunchback. We must develop the correct sitting posture in daily life. Let’s briefly describe how to correct a child’s hunchback.

First, understand the essentials of correct posture. You can use the ballet body training method, with your heels together and your feet open 180 degrees to form a "one". The easiest way to correct a hunchback is to stand with your back against a wall, which is a daily exercise for fashion models. You can also raise your front foot, for example, by putting your foot on a book (more than 20 mm thick). Regularly practicing this standing posture can gradually correct your hunchback. This is also a new method of dance body training and has a scientific basis.

Second, use body corrective shoes. Body correction shoes are also called body training shoes. This type of shoe is higher in the front and lower in the back. It is the same as the method of raising the forefoot to correct hunchback mentioned above, but this method is simpler, more lifelike and more regular, and easier to stick to for a long time. Body training shoes are basically the same as ordinary shoes in appearance and can be used as daily shoes. There are many repeat customers who make repeat purchases. In addition, you can try doing the correct stretch before sleeping: lie on your back with your feet shoulder-width apart, knees bent and together, hands raised above your head and laid flat, palms facing up or inward. It doesn’t matter if your arms can’t be straightened at first; the longer you hold it, the better the effect. Zhengzhiben stretching can effectively correct the posture of the neck, shoulders and back, and has significant effects on cervical spondylosis and hunchback, significantly optimizing the neck and shoulder lines and lengthening the neck.

It is relatively easy to correct hunchbacks in children because their bones are not yet fully developed. As long as we take appropriate methods to help ourselves correct it, we can achieve a good correction effect. During the correction process, we must hold our heads high and chest out when walking, and never walk with a bent back.
